## Deployment

Wavecrest renders audio waveform previews server-side and serves them as static PNGs from the Fennelgate CDN tier. The renderer runs in an unprivileged container with no outbound network access beyond the blob store. Uploads are scanned before rendering, and preview artifacts expire after thirty days. For the security review, the deployed configuration is reproduced below.

config for hahip-kaguf:
[holath]
port = 8443
region = north-4
host = holath.tolvaqlabs.internal
timeout_ms = 1000
retries = 2

## Ticket: Planner regression traced to config drift

The Ordwell query planner began choosing nested-loop joins for mid-size scans after last week's rollout. Profiling shows the cost model thresholds on two replicas no longer match the fleet baseline; drift likely came from a manual hotfix that was never reverted. Plugin authors relying on planner hints should treat those replicas as untrusted until reconciliation completes. To help reproduce the regression, we are pinning the divergent replica settings here.

settings of tagef-bawif:
DRUIX_HOST=druix.zemvarlabs.internal
DRUIX_PORT=8000

## Break-glass: Snapshot test baselines

Hey new folks — our UI snapshot baselines for the Fernwick component library live in a locked archive so nobody casually regenerates them and hides regressions. Normally CI handles everything. But if CI is down and you absolutely must update baselines for a release, that's a break-glass situation. Ping a lead first, then unlock the archive using the recovery passphrase below.

vault phrase of tajeg-tageg = pelix-druix-holius-briael-zorwyn-frawyn-fraox-norok-drueth-aldiel

TaxVault is the lookup cache sitting between Ledgerbird's billing service and the upstream rate provider. It refreshes jurisdictions nightly and serves stale-but-valid entries during provider outages. Most problems are cache-invalidation related: check the refresh job logs before filing anything. Known gotcha: regional overrides in the Veltmark dataset occasionally arrive out of order, which the reconciler handles on the next cycle. For persistent discrepancies, open an issue with the jurisdiction code, or write to the maintainers directly.

escalation mailbox, bafog-fafog: ulador@paliqlabs.internal